How to Improve Business Productivity: Practical Strategies for Success

Every successful company depends on strong business productivity. However, many organizations struggle with inefficient processes, poor communication, and time management issues. These challenges can reduce performance, increase costs, and slow business growth.

Moreover, improving productivity is not about working longer hours. It is about using time, people, and resources more effectively. Businesses that focus on productivity often complete tasks faster, improve customer satisfaction, and achieve better financial results.

This guide explains practical strategies to improve business productivity, increase workplace efficiency, and support long-term success.

What Is Business Productivity?

Business productivity measures how efficiently a company uses its resources to achieve goals. In addition, it shows how much value a business creates with the available time, money, and workforce.

Understanding Productivity

A productive business completes more work while using fewer resources.

Productivity depends on:

  • Employee performance
  • Efficient workflows
  • Smart technology
  • Time management
  • Clear communication

As a result, businesses can improve profits while reducing unnecessary expenses.

Why Productivity Matters

Productivity affects every department within an organization.

Higher productivity can lead to:

  • Better customer service
  • Faster project completion
  • Lower operating costs
  • Increased revenue
  • Stronger business growth

Therefore, improving productivity should be a priority for every business owner.

Why Business Productivity Is Important

Every organization wants to achieve sustainable growth. Furthermore, improving business productivity helps companies remain competitive in today’s market.

Better Business Performance

Productive businesses operate more efficiently.

This often results in:

  • Higher output
  • Improved quality
  • Faster decision-making
  • Better customer satisfaction
  • Increased profitability

Consequently, businesses gain a competitive advantage.

Employee Satisfaction

Employees perform better when they work in an organized environment.

Businesses that improve productivity often provide:

  • Clear responsibilities
  • Better communication
  • Modern tools
  • Professional development
  • Supportive leadership

As a result, employee motivation and job satisfaction increase.

Common Causes of Low Productivity

Many businesses lose valuable time because of avoidable problems. However, identifying these issues is the first step toward improvement.

Poor Time Management

Without proper planning, employees may spend too much time on low-priority tasks.

Common problems include:

  • Missed deadlines
  • Frequent interruptions
  • Poor scheduling
  • Lack of planning
  • Unclear priorities

Therefore, effective time management is essential.

Weak Communication

Poor communication creates confusion across teams.

Examples include:

  • Unclear instructions
  • Delayed responses
  • Missing information
  • Misunderstood goals

Consequently, projects take longer to complete and productivity decreases.

Improve Time Management

Managing time effectively is one of the fastest ways to improve business productivity. Moreover, organized schedules help employees stay focused throughout the workday.

Prioritize Important Tasks

Not every task has the same level of importance.

Employees should:

  • Complete urgent work first
  • Set daily priorities
  • Break large projects into smaller tasks
  • Avoid unnecessary distractions

As a result, teams complete more work in less time.

Create Daily Work Plans

Planning each day improves organization.

A simple schedule helps employees:

  • Stay focused
  • Meet deadlines
  • Track progress
  • Reduce stress

Therefore, daily planning supports consistent business performance.

Set Clear Business Goals

Every productive business works toward clear objectives. Furthermore, defined goals help employees understand what they need to accomplish.

Short-Term Goals

Short-term goals improve daily productivity.

Examples include:

  • Completing projects on time
  • Improving customer response time
  • Increasing weekly sales
  • Reducing workflow delays

Consequently, businesses see faster operational improvements.

Long-Term Goals

Long-term goals support business growth.

These goals may include:

  • Expanding into new markets
  • Increasing annual revenue
  • Improving brand reputation
  • Growing the customer base

As a result, employees remain focused on the company’s long-term vision.

Technology helps businesses complete tasks faster and with greater accuracy. Moreover, the right digital tools reduce manual work and improve overall efficiency. Companies that invest in modern technology often experience better workflow management and higher employee performance.

Automate Repetitive Tasks

Automation saves valuable time by handling routine activities.

Businesses can automate:

  • Email marketing
  • Invoice generation
  • Data entry
  • Appointment scheduling
  • Customer follow-ups

As a result, employees can focus on more important business activities.

Use Productivity Software

Modern software improves teamwork and project management.

Popular business tools help teams:

  • Organize projects
  • Track deadlines
  • Share documents
  • Monitor progress
  • Improve communication

Therefore, businesses complete projects more efficiently.

Build a Productive Team

A motivated team plays a major role in improving business productivity. Furthermore, employees perform better when they receive support, training, and clear direction.

Encourage Team Collaboration

Collaboration allows employees to solve problems more effectively.

Businesses should encourage:

  • Team meetings
  • Open communication
  • Knowledge sharing
  • Group problem-solving
  • Employee feedback

Consequently, teamwork increases efficiency and improves decision-making.

Invest in Employee Training

Training helps employees develop new skills and improve existing ones.

Regular training can:

  • Increase confidence
  • Improve work quality
  • Reduce mistakes
  • Enhance productivity
  • Support career growth

As a result, businesses build a stronger and more capable workforce.

Improve Workplace Communication

Clear communication keeps projects moving smoothly. Moreover, employees work more efficiently when expectations are clearly explained.

Hold Regular Meetings

Short meetings help teams stay informed.

These meetings allow employees to:

  • Review project progress
  • Discuss challenges
  • Set priorities
  • Share updates

Therefore, communication becomes more effective.

Provide Clear Instructions

Employees perform better when tasks are explained properly.

Managers should:

  • Set realistic deadlines
  • Define responsibilities
  • Explain project goals
  • Answer employee questions

Consequently, fewer mistakes occur during daily operations.

Common Productivity Mistakes

Many businesses unknowingly reduce productivity through poor habits. However, avoiding these mistakes can improve performance.

Multitasking Too Much

Handling several tasks at once often reduces work quality.

Instead, employees should:

  • Focus on one task
  • Complete important work first
  • Minimize distractions
  • Review completed work

As a result, accuracy and efficiency improve.

Ignoring Employee Feedback

Employees often identify problems before management does.

Listening to feedback helps businesses:

  • Improve workflows
  • Solve operational issues
  • Increase employee engagement
  • Build trust

Therefore, feedback should become part of every business strategy.

Tips for Long-Term Business Success

Improving business productivity requires continuous effort. Furthermore, successful businesses regularly evaluate their processes and make necessary improvements.

Measure Performance

Tracking performance helps identify strengths and weaknesses.

Businesses should monitor:

  • Employee productivity
  • Project completion rates
  • Customer satisfaction
  • Revenue growth
  • Operational efficiency

Consequently, managers can make better business decisions.

Focus on Continuous Improvement

Successful companies always look for ways to improve.

This may include:

  • Updating technology
  • Improving customer service
  • Simplifying workflows
  • Providing employee training
  • Reviewing business goals

Ultimately, continuous improvement supports sustainable business growth.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is business productivity?

Business productivity measures how efficiently a company uses its resources to produce goods or deliver services while achieving its goals.

How can technology improve business productivity?

Technology automates routine tasks, improves communication, supports project management, and helps employees complete work more efficiently.

Why is time management important in business?

Good time management helps employees meet deadlines, reduce stress, and complete more work without sacrificing quality.

How does employee training improve productivity?

Training improves skills, reduces mistakes, increases confidence, and helps employees adapt to new tools and processes.

What is the biggest obstacle to business productivity?

Poor communication, ineffective planning, weak leadership, and unnecessary distractions are among the most common productivity challenges.

Conclusion

Improving business productivity is essential for achieving long-term growth and maintaining a competitive advantage. Moreover, businesses that manage time effectively, adopt modern technology, encourage teamwork, and invest in employee development often achieve better results.

Whether you operate a small business or a large organization, consistent improvement should remain a priority. Ultimately, combining clear goals, efficient workflows, and continuous learning will help increase productivity, improve customer satisfaction, and support lasting business success.
